Sunday: New England remains cool and wet as the Northern Plains prepares for the next round of severe weather

The Northeast will be cool on Sunday with many locations being 10 to 20 degrees below normal. New England will mostly be wet with rain likely; however, the higher elevations in New England will see accumulating snowfall. Scattered thunderstorms are in the forecast for the Northern Plains, some of which could be severe.

7-DAY FORECAST

  • Tonight Snow showers likely, mainly after 11pm. Some thunder is also possible. Cloudy, then gradually becoming partly cloudy, with a low around 16. Breezy, with a southwest wind 15 to 20 mph increasing to 24 to 29 mph in the evening. Winds could gust as high as 44 mph. Chance of precipitation is 60%. Total nighttime snow accumulation of less than a half inch possible.
  • Sunday Snow showers. Temperature rising to near 25 by 8am, then falling to around 18 during the remainder of the day. Windy, with a west southwest wind 31 to 37 mph, with gusts as high as 55 mph. Chance of precipitation is 100%. New snow accumulation of less than a half inch possible.
  • Sunday Night A 40 percent chance of snow showers before 11pm. Partly cloudy, with a temperature rising to around 23 by 5am. Windy, with a west southwest wind 29 to 37 mph, with gusts as high as 55 mph. New snow accumulation of less than a half inch possible.
  • Memorial Day Snow. High near 26. Windy, with a west wind around 38 mph, with gusts as high as 55 mph. Chance of precipitation is 100%. New snow accumulation of 2 to 4 inches possible.
  • Monday Night Snow showers likely, mainly before 11pm. Partly cloudy, with a low around 17. Windy, with a west wind 36 to 46 mph, with gusts as high as 70 mph. Chance of precipitation is 70%. New snow accumulation of 1 to 2 inches possible.
  • Tuesday A 40 percent chance of snow showers. Mostly sunny, with a high near 25. Windy. New snow accumulation of less than a half inch possible.
  • Tuesday Night A 50 percent chance of snow. Mostly cloudy, with a low around 13. Windy. New snow accumulation of less than a half inch possible.
  • Wednesday A chance of snow showers. Mostly cloudy, with a high near 24.
  • Wednesday Night A chance of snow showers. Mostly cloudy, with a low around 17.
  • Thursday A slight chance of snow showers. Partly sunny, with a high near 28. Blustery.
  • Thursday Night Partly cloudy, with a low around 24. Blustery.
  • Friday Mostly sunny, with a high near 30. Blustery.
  • Friday Night Partly cloudy, with a low around 24.
  • Saturday Mostly sunny, with a high near 34.
